For mid-19th-century Americans, the Mexican War was not only a grand exercise in self-identity, legitimizing the young republic''s convictions of mission and destiny to a doubting world; it was also the first American conflict to be widely reported in the press and to be waged against an alien foe in a distant and exotic land.
